2. Complete Hardscaping and Stonework Expertise
Hardscaping is where quality becomes obvious. A poorly built patio will crack within a year. Uneven pavers create tripping hazards. Weak retaining walls shift with seasonal moisture. These aren't just aesthetic problems; they're safety and structural issues that compound over time.
Our hardscaping team brings years of hands-on experience with materials like natural stone, pavers, brick, and retaining wall systems. We handle proper base preparation, slope and drainage grading, and installation techniques that stand up to Louisiana's climate. Whether it's a backyard entertaining patio, a professional paver installation for a driveway, or decorative stonework, we treat every project with the same precision.

We also understand local soil conditions and weather patterns in the Lafayette area. That knowledge directly affects how we prepare foundations and select materials. A patio built without accounting for our humid, occasionally wet season will fail. We design every project to perform, not just look good on day one.

3. Advanced Underground Irrigation and Drainage Solutions
A beautiful landscape becomes expensive to maintain if it's constantly waterlogged or requires hand-watering twice a day. The problem often starts underground, where drainage and irrigation planning get overlooked.
We design and install underground irrigation systems that water efficiently based on plant needs, seasonal changes, and rainfall. Smart controllers let you adjust watering from your phone, and drip irrigation delivers water directly to roots, reducing waste. For properties with drainage challenges, we install solutions that route excess water away from foundations and soft areas, protecting your landscape investment long-term.
These systems aren't add-ons; they're essential infrastructure. Poor drainage leads to dying plants, eroded soil, and structural problems. Inefficient irrigation wastes money and water while creating disease-prone conditions for plant roots. When we design your landscape, irrigation and drainage are built into the plan from day one, not added as an afterthought.

6. Quality Artificial Turf and Sod Installation Services
Choosing between natural sod and artificial turf installation isn't simple. Real grass is traditional and feels natural, but it demands consistent watering, mowing, and care. Artificial turf eliminates maintenance but requires the right choice of material and proper installation.
We specialize in both options and will honestly assess which makes sense for your situation. If you choose sod, we source quality grass suited to our climate and install it properly so it establishes quickly. If you go with artificial turf, we select materials that look natural, perform well in heat, and are installed with proper base preparation and drainage to prevent pooling and deterioration.
The installation quality directly determines how long either option lasts. Poor sod prep or artificial turf installation without attention to slope and underlay leads to failure within a few years. We take the time to do it right the first time.

7. Expert Outdoor and Holiday Lighting to Transform Your Property
Lighting does two jobs: it showcases your landscape and extends your outdoor living season. Most properties undersell themselves after dark simply because the lighting is an afterthought.

We design outdoor lighting systems that highlight architectural features, create ambiance for entertaining, and provide security. Pathway lights guide safely, uplighting on trees adds drama, and subtle accent lighting on hardscape brings detail into focus. Holiday lighting takes this further, turning your property into a memorable seasonal display that stands out in the neighborhood.
Professional outdoor lighting requires understanding fixture placement, bulb type, voltage systems, and aesthetic balance. It's not something you piece together with mismatched solar stakes and hardware store fixtures. A well-designed lighting plan looks intentional and transforms how your property feels after sunset.
